Career path

Career Role Description
Cheminformatics Data Scientist (UK) Develops and applies advanced cheminformatics algorithms for drug discovery and materials science. High demand for strong programming and statistical skills.
Computational Chemist (UK) Utilizes computational methods to design and analyze molecules, focusing on quantum chemistry and molecular dynamics simulations. Key skills include modeling and simulation expertise.
Bioinformatics Scientist (Cheminformatics Focus) (UK) Applies cheminformatics principles to biological data, often in genomics, proteomics, and drug development. Requires proficiency in data analysis and biological databases.
Senior Cheminformatics Analyst (UK) Leads cheminformatics projects, guiding junior team members and mentoring their development in data analysis and interpretation. Extensive experience in data visualization is essential.
